Skip to content

Aplicação de uma pokédex que lista todos os primeiros 151 passando diversas informações, como nome, foto, ataques, entre outros atributos.

Notifications You must be signed in to change notification settings

Joaovcarvalho23/projeto_pokedex_reactjs

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

20 Commits
 
 
 
 

Repository files navigation

Link do aplicativo: https://jv-pokedex.vercel.app/

Olá! Bem vindo ao Pokédex App!

-> Este projeto consiste listar os primeiros 151 Pokémons, onde o usuário é capaz de visualizar todos esses Pokémons e, ao clicar em algum Pokémon, o usuário é direcionado para outra página, onde mostra as seguintes informações do Pokémon escolhido:

  • Foto do Pokémon;
  • Nome do Pokémon;
  • Peso do Pokémon;
  • Altura do Pokémon;
  • As variações daquele Pokémon;
  • Lista de todos os ataques do Pokémon;

-> Após a consulta dessas informações, o usuário deve clicar na casinha preta localizada no canto superior direito da sua tela, para poder voltar ao menu inicial do aplicativo.

-> Foi implementado um Search Bar (barra de pesquisa) junto com um sistema de filtragem de nome, no qual o usuário pode pesquisar o nome do Pokémon desejado e obter suas informações. Vamos exemplificar a funcionalidade do search bar: Suponhamos que existe uma lista gigantesca de nomes aleatórios. Sabendo disso, se o usuário digitar os caracteres 'Jo', o retorno será nomes que começam apenas com as iniciais 'Jo', como 'João', 'José', 'Jonas', 'Joelma', etc. Caso o nome digitado pelo usuário esteja errado, o mesmo pode apagar todo o campo de pesquisa, fazendo-o voltar ao menu inicial do aplicativo.

-> O aplicativo está responsivo para PCs, tablets/iPads e smartphones

-> Todas as informações dos Pokémons são extraídas a partir de uma requisição à API https://pokeapi.co/

About

Aplicação de uma pokédex que lista todos os primeiros 151 passando diversas informações, como nome, foto, ataques, entre outros atributos.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published